Flavorful Smoky BBQ Bacon Cheeseburger Sliders

These smoky BBQ bacon cheeseburger sliders are perfect party bites featuring juicy beef patties, crispy bacon, melted cheddar cheese, and a tangy smoky BBQ sauce on soft slider buns.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 pound (450 g) ground beef (80/20 blend)
  • 12 slider buns
  • 68 thick-cut bacon strips
  • 6 cheddar cheese slices
  • ½ cup (120 ml) smoky BBQ sauce
  • 2 tablespoons (30 ml) yellow mustard
  • Sliced pickles (optional)
  • ¼ cup (40 g) finely diced onion
  • Salt to taste
  • Freshly ground black p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ons (30 g) melted butter

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Cook the bacon in a skillet over medium heat until crisp, about 6-8 minutes, flipping occasionally. Drain on paper towels and slice each strip in half to fit slider buns.
  3. In a mixing bowl, combine ground beef, diced onion, 1 teaspoon salt, and ½ teaspoon black pepper. Mix gently with your hands.
  4. Form 12 small patties, about 2 ounces (55 g) each, making a slight indentation in the center of each patty with your thumb.
  5. Heat a large skillet or grill pan over medium-high heat. Cook patties for about 3 minutes per side for medium doneness without pressing down.
  6. After flipping patties, brush the cooked side with smoky BBQ sauce. Flip again, add half a slice of cheddar cheese on top, and cover the pan for 1-2 minutes until cheese melts.
  7. Split slider buns and brush insides with melted butter. Place on a baking sheet and toast in the oven for 3-4 minutes until golden.
  8. Assemble sliders by placing a cheese-topped patty on the bottom bun, adding two halves of cooked bacon, and optional pickles. Spread a thin layer of yellow mustard on the top bun and close the sliders.
  9. Return the assembled sliders to the oven for 5 minutes to meld flavors and warm through.
  10. Serve immediately while hot and fresh.

Notes

Do not overwork the meat to keep patties tender. Make a thumb indentation in patties to prevent puffing. Brush BBQ sauce after flipping patties to avoid burning. Toast buns with melted butter to prevent sogginess. Cook bacon and patties ahead to save time and warm before serving.
